About Y. Ho

Y. Ho is a scholar working on Atomic and Molecular Physics, and Optics, Instrumentation, Radiation, Electrical and Electronic Engineering and Nuclear and High Energy Physics, having authored 2 papers that have together received 5 indexed citations. Recurring topics across this work include Adaptive optics and wavefront sensing (1 paper), Atomic and Subatomic Physics Research (1 paper), Particle Detector Development and Performance (1 paper), Astronomy and Astrophysical Research (1 paper), Nuclear Physics and Applications (1 paper) and CCD and CMOS Imaging Sensors (1 paper). The work is most often cited by research in Instrumentation (1 citation), Nuclear and High Energy Physics (2 citations), Astronomy and Astrophysics (2 citations), Radiation (1 citation) and Aerospace Engineering (2 citations). Y. Ho has collaborated with scholars based in United States and Japan. Frequent co-authors include T. Mori, N. M. Shaw, Michael Merrill, R. Schmidt, Y. Higashi, Hong Zheng, J. Edwards, Gustavo Rahmer, Michael Warner and T. Haelen. Their work appears in journals such as Nuclear Instruments and Methods in Physics Research Section A Accelerators Spectrometers Detectors and Associated Equipment and Proceedings of SPIE, the International Society for Optical Engineering/Proceedings of SPIE.
